How to type the loss function L symbol and other special letters in MathType

formula sample

Method: Copy the command below and paste it into mathtype.

\mathcal{L}


Note:
1. You can only copy and paste text, and it is invalid to enter it yourself. The letter L inside can be modified, such as changing to \mathcal{A}

2. It is recommended to type a few letters in the formula before pasting , because the format of the current position will be changed after pasting the command. If you enter this symbol immediately, the content of the keyboard input may be a blank character. At this time, you can move the cursor to the next position, as long as it is not next to the instruction symbol, you can input normally.
